Drains That Are Slow Even After Store-Bought Treatments

If you’ve already tried a liquid drain cleaner and the water is still pooling in your sink or tub, the clog is likely deeper in the line than those products can reach. Chemical drain cleaners can also damage older pipes over time, which is a real concern in Osburn homes with aging plumbing. A plumber can clear it properly without adding wear to the pipe.

Recurring Clogs in Osburn’s Older Homes

Many homes in Osburn were built in the mid-20th century, and some still have original cast iron or galvanized steel drain lines. These pipes corrode from the inside over time, creating rough surfaces that catch grease and debris much more easily than modern PVC. If the same drain keeps blocking every few months, it’s worth having a plumber inspect the line rather than repeatedly treating the symptom. Foul Odors Coming from Drains

A persistent smell coming from a drain, even when it seems to be flowing fine, often means organic buildup has collected inside the pipe. In some cases it can also signal a venting issue or a dry trap. Either way, it’s not something to ignore, especially if the smell is getting stronger.

Most drain cleaning jobs in Osburn run between $120 and $350, depending on the location of the clog and the method needed to clear it. A straightforward kitchen or bathroom drain is usually on the lower end, while a main sewer line that needs hydro-jetting will cost more. We provide upfront pricing before any work begins so there are no surprises.

A typical drain cleaning appointment in Osburn takes between 30 minutes and two hours. Simple clogs in a single fixture can often be cleared in under an hour, while main line blockages or jobs that require camera inspection take longer. We give you a realistic timeframe when you call so you can plan your day.

Standard drain cleaning and clog removal does not require a permit in Osburn. Permits are generally only needed when you are replacing or rerouting drain lines as part of a larger plumbing project. If your situation does require a permit, Plumbn H20 handles the paperwork with the Shoshone County building department on your behalf.

Yes, tree root intrusion is one of the more common causes of slow or blocked drains in Osburn, particularly in homes with older clay or cast iron sewer lines. Roots follow moisture and can crack into pipe joints over time. We use camera inspection to confirm root intrusion and hydro-jetting or mechanical cutting to clear it.
